Eastern Sufism

E1630727 UNEXPLORED

Eastern Sufism refers to the diverse mystical traditions and practices of Sufism that developed primarily in the Islamic heartlands of the Middle East and Central and South Asia, often emphasizing spiritual discipline, devotional love, and esoteric interpretation of Islamic teachings.
